Training Course Overview
The Effective Budgeting & Operational Cost Control training course offers essential guidance in managing financial performance. Effective budgeting and operational cost control are crucial for organizations to maintain competitiveness by adopting best practices and employing appropriate planning and control tools to enhance value for customers and shareholders. Activities such as budget preparation, analysis, and cost management ensure the alignment with long-term strategic goals.
This training course comprehensively covers these critical areas, catering to anyone involved in budgeting and cost management responsibilities at various levels—whether departmental, business unit, project, or organizational.
This Anderson course will feature:
- Practical management accounting applications
- The budget process and best practice
- Traditional and alternative methods of budgeting and cost control
- Purposes and benefits of cost analysis
- KPIs and the balanced scorecard

The Course Outline
- The key role of budgeting and cost control in contemporary organisations
- Budgetary planning and control
- The importance of value – for customers and shareholders
- Financial accounting and management accounting
- Integrating the financial and non-financial aspects of budgeting
- Financial planning and the budgeting process
- The key features of budgeting
- Advantages and disadvantages of budgeting
- Divisionalisation and responsibility accounting
- Operating budgets: zero-based, incremental, and activity-based
- Capital budgets
- Cash budgets
- Different costs for different purposes
- Fixed costs and variable costs
- Cost-volume-profit (CVP) analysis
- Contribution and marginal costing
- Absorption costing
- Decision-making
- Indirect costs (overheads) and direct costs
- Under-costing and over-costing: the consequences for profitability
- Traditional cost allocation systems and activity based costing (ABC)
- Refinement of the costing system
- Activity based budgeting (ABB)
- Standard costing, flexed budgets, and variance analysis
- Broadening performance measurement systems
- Innovative approaches to costing
- Integrating financial and non-financial performance measures
- The balanced scorecard
- Strategy maps
- Six sigma
